It can be challenging to detect AI-written content, as technology is constantly evolving and becoming more sophisticated. However, there are a few things you can look out for that may indicate that the content was generated by an AI:

1. Lack of human error: AI-written content is often free of grammatical errors, typos, or inconsistencies that are commonly found in human-written content.

2. Generic or robotic tone: AI-generated content may lack a personal touch and come across as generic or robotic in tone.

3. Unusual word choices or phrasing: AI algorithms may use language in a way that seems unnatural or unusual for human writers.

4. Repetitiveness: AI-written content may repeat certain phrases or information throughout the text, as the algorithm may generate content based on patterns and formulas.

5. Lack of creativity or originality: AI-generated content may lack creativity, originality, or unique insights that are commonly found in human writing.

Overall, it can be difficult to definitively determine if content was written by an AI, but paying attention to these factors can help you make an educated guess. Additionally, there are tools available that can help analyze content for AI-generated characteristics.
